As long as there have been humans, we have gathered by rivers and hot springs, oceans and lakes, to cleanse and sweat, rejuvenate and relax

Ancient Greeks bathed to purify themselves before entering a temple; ancient Chinese physicians prescribed cold-water swimming to cure illnesses. Bathing took us closer to God and further from disease.

Drawing on deep, original reporting, science and psychology, as well as historical archives, Melissa Godin explores bathing cultures around the world, revealing how elemental bathing is to the human experience. We will sweat in the hammams of Morocco; wade into the polluted but holy waters of the Ganges; wash in the historic bathhouses of San Francisco; and swim in the cold-waters of Britain.
